How to make more nutritious choices while dining out


  • Opt for a side of greens like a side salad, grilled or roasted veggies, coleslaw, mashed potatoes, collard greens…etc. This way, you’ll ensure you have your serving of vegetables for at least one meal of your day.
  • Order a smaller portion, or eat only half your order to ensure you have leftovers for lunch tomorrow. You can always opt to share your dish with the person you’re dining with, too. If you’re eating family style, consider only taking one spoonful of each dish so you can try everything at least once instead of loading up a mountain of food on your plate all at once.
  • Hydrate with water rather than a sugary soda. If you have trouble remembering to drink water during your day, an easy way to get your water intake is by incorporating at least one glass of water with every meal.
  • Choose ‘grilled’ or ‘baked’ over ‘fried’ when there’s an option. Yes, we love a crispy piece of fried chicken, but if you had that yesterday, maybe try a grilled chicken today. Or opt for a baked potato over French fries.
  • Don’t touch that salt shaker. Try to limit your sodium intake by avoiding excessive salt. Try savoring the natural flavors of your meal just as it is. 
  • Try fresh fruit for dessert. This can be super difficult, we know! But fruit is a great way to satisfy your sweet tooth.

Shop Smart

If you’re unable to make it to local farmers’ markets, there are still ways to make healthier choices while grocery shopping. Here are a few tips on how to shop smart:


  • Create shopping lists to avoid buying unnecessary items. This not only helps reduce food waste but also saves you money.
  • Pay attention to the ingredients listed on packaged foods. Avoid items with excessive added sugars, artificial additives, or that are high in sodium.
  • Buy what you need to avoid food waste and save money. While you may love seeing a fully-stocked fridge, it may not be feasible to store all that food if you won’t eat it before it goes bad.
  • Try new recipes. Experimenting can introduce you to a wider variety of nutritious ingredients. Look for healthy recipes online and make it fun by cooking with loved ones or challenge yourself by trying a new recipe a week.
  • Plan and prep your meals. If you’re a routine person, meal planning and prepping is a great time saver. You can prep frozen breakfast egg bites or wraps if you’re always running a bit behind after hitting snooze. Preparing your lunch the night before helps save you money from buying a lunch during your workday. Having everything you need to make a delicious homemade dinner is a relief after a long day.


If you have the space and are willing, consider growing your own vegetables or herbs. Urban gardening is so rewarding, and it can be done in small spaces, too!
